Overview: During a recent Pasco County Planning Commission meeting, community dissent arose surrounding a request for a special exception to allow the development of duplexes in Lakewood Acres, a move that residents argued would disrupt the single-family character of their neighborhood. Anne Warter, a resident, voiced her strong opposition, highlighting concerns about increased traffic, infrastructure strain, and potential declines in property values. “Allowing multifamily dwellings such as duplexes will fundamentally alter the fabric of our community,” she stated, echoing the sentiments of many who attended the meeting.

Overview: At a recent meeting of the Pasco County Metropolitan Planning Organization (MPO), public resistance to the proposed Air’s Road extension project emerged as the most prominent topic. Residents expressed concerns over environmental impacts, the preservation of rural character, and the potential increase in traffic accidents. The meeting also covered updates on various transportation projects, including amendments to the Transportation Improvement Program and discussions on infrastructure improvements.

Overview: The recent Pasco County Council meeting saw a range of discussions, from road safety concerns and infrastructure funding to backyard chicken regulations. Residents of Lanier Road voiced urgent concerns about road safety, while the council debated funding mechanisms for infrastructure improvements and the simplification of regulations for keeping backyard chickens.

Overview: At the recent Pasco County Planning Commission meeting, discussions centered around the proposal for a gate at Renest Drive, intended to address traffic and safety concerns in the Meadow Point 2 Community Development District (CDD). This proposition has sparked debate among residents over its potential impact on local traffic patterns and safety, particularly in light of two traumatic incidents where individuals were airlifted after being struck by vehicles on this roadway.

Overview: During a recent Pasco County Council meeting, discussions revolved around several issues, with the proposed ordinance on backyard chickens taking center stage. The council considered removing permit requirements for chicken ownership in residential areas. The proposed ordinance, set for further discussion in November, sparked a lively exchange as residents and council members weighed the benefits of backyard chickens against potential regulatory hurdles.
